Tenecteplase Versus Alteplase in Ischemic Stroke Management (TALISMAN)

Withdrawn before enrolling · Phase 2/Phase 3

Conditions studied: Ischemic Stroke

In brief

This is a double-blind parallel arm randomized trial aimed to assess efficacy and safety of intravenous Tenecteplase compared to intravenous Alteplase in eligible patients who present with symptoms of acute ischemic stroke within 3 to 4.5 hours from onset.
